    Key Responsibilities:

    This position is responsible for the strategic management of the client's critical environment infrastructure (including co-lo sites), FM engineering and practical delivery of best-in-class operational standards resulting in an excellent engineering service provision across the EMEA region. You will be an evangelist for engineering best practice and act as a trusted advisor to the client, supporting the development of engineering standards.

    Operational management of CBRE's specialist M&E Supply Chain and OEM's in order to deliver a best in class service with the ultimate objective of meeting the Key Performance Indicators and Service Level Agreements targets across EMEA countries.

    • Responsible for in scope all engineering service delivery in the EMEA region
    • Provide support to the Global Engineering Lead/Account Director, providing tactical and operational delivery reports as well as Supply Partner management and direction across the region as required.
    • Use data to driver monitor, report on and drive performance of the engineering team across the region.
    • Provide leadership, support and guidance to sub-region engineering leads to ensure effective, timely and complete delivery of the service provider's deliverables in accordance to the service level agreement and contract.
    • Manage regional incident and escalation, lead engineering problem solving, fault finding and root cause analysis for the region acting as the primary interface with the client, local vendor partner, and other stakeholders.
    • Conduct regular reviews of existing operations to ensure maintenance and operating standards and environments are adequate for each facility. Implement the standards for inspection and audit protocols for the improvement and/or maintenance of operational delivery.
    • Provide financial oversight including review engineering capital budgets, ensure effective management of the Repairs and Maintenance (R&M) cost, providing budget variance reports and assisting with annual reconciliations.
    • Performs additional job duties as requested. Some travel required.
    Essential Skills:

    Excellent client relationship and leadership skills
    Strong communication and presentation skills
    Ability to effectively respond to complex inquiries, requests or complaints from clients, line management and supply chain,
    Experience in change control and engineering planning tools and processes
    Strong financial control to maintain cost within budget.
    Intermediate skill with Microsoft Office Suite,
    Relevant experience managing an engineering service delivery across multiple remote and culturally different :

    Tertiary qualification in Engineering Studies preferable with Degree in Mechanical or Electrical Engineering.
    A minimum of ten years post training experience, five years of which in maintaining critical engineering environments.
    Member of an Engineering related professional institutions i.e. ASHRAE/CIBSE/IEE.

    CBRE Group, Inc. is the world's largest commercial real estate services and investment firm, with 2019 revenues of $23.9 billion and more than 100,000 employees (excluding affiliate offices). CBRE has been included on the Fortune 500 since 2008, ranking #128 in 2020. It also has been voted the industry's top brand by the Lipsey Company for 19 consecutive years, and has been named one of Fortune's "Most Admired Companies" for eight years in a row, including being ranked number one in the real estate sector in 2020, for the second consecutive year. Its shares trade on the New York Stock Exchange under the symbol "CBRE."
